SG Biofuels Claims Advance

San Diego-based SG Biofuels, the firm using biotechnology and other techniques to develop hybrid seeds of Jatropha for the biofuels industry, claimed today that it has reached a "significant milestone" in its efforts. The firm, which is backed by Life Technologies and others, said it is applying more than 1.6 million genetic markers (SNPs) to produce elite, high performance cultivars of Jatropha. Jatropha is an oil rich plant from Central America, which is being targeted as a good source of biofuels feedstock. The firm said the milestone will accelerate identification and development of specific genetic traits in Jatropha.
